Gregory Jackson, a 19-year-old player for the Grizzlies, had an outstanding performance against the Warriors, scoring 23 points, 6 rebounds, 2 steals, and 2 blocks with impressive shooting percentages. His reaction to hearing Shaquille O'Neal in his postgame interview was heartwarming and widely praised. Jackson's achievement of back-to-back 20+ point games at such a young age drew comparisons to LeBron James. His interaction with Shaq has been described as wholesome and a highlight of his breakout game.
